Program Description
USAID's Office of Transition Initiatives (OTI) Venezuela program was part of a larger U.S. Government effort to support democratic stability and build confidence among and between political leaders and civil society in Venezuela. The program supported the work of civil society organizations, diverse members of all political parties, and human rights organizations across the political spectrum to provide an opportunity for open debate and dialogue on key citizen issues while promoting multi-party, multi-sectoral citizen participation.
For internal management reasons, OTI officially transferred its Venezuela program to the USAID Latin American and Caribbean Bureau on December 31, 2010, after eight years of operation. The program will continue to strengthen democratic governance, support civic engagement, promote human rights, and expand national dialogue.
